Damages that can be recovered in a truck accident claim

While physical injuries and financial losses are the main focus of truck accident claims, non-economic damages can also be collected to cover the costs of recovery and future expenses. Damages to property may include medical bills, prescription glasses, and personal items. Loss of work may also be incurred due to physical or emotional pain. Other types of damages may also be recovered, including travel expenses, loss of enjoyment of life, and future medical costs.

Liability of parties in a truck accident

A truck accident can have many different parties. Depending on the circumstances, several parties may be held liable, which can make it difficult to decide which is to blame. In some instances, the trucking company is partially or completely at fault. For example, the employer may be liable for the conduct of its employee while acting within the scope of employment. If the employer is partially to blame, a qualified truck accident lawyer can help victims navigate the claims process.

Evidence needed for a truck accident claim

The evidence needed for a truck accident claim varies depending on who is at fault in the crash. If the accident was the result of negligence on the part of a trucker, eyewitness statements may be essential to your case. Obtain the telephone numbers and addresses of eyewitnesses and obtain their statements. In addition, get hold of the trucker’s cellphone records, which can help establish if he or she was texting or talking on the phone before the accident. Medical bills and records are also important and can be used to prove the severity of injuries and the amount of compensation the driver must pay.

Deadlines for filing a truck accident claim

Most truck accidents are settled out of court. However, how long does a truck accident claim take to settle? Also, did you know you have a limited amount of time to file a lawsuit after an accident? You should be aware that most claims have a two-year statute of limitations, which means that you must file your lawsuit before this deadline passes. Otherwise, your case may be dismissed, or the at-fault driver’s insurance company will not pay out your claim. Deadlines for filing a truck accident claim are extremely important.

Settlement offers from insurance companies

Be careful about accepting the first settlement offer you receive from an insurance company for your truck accident claim. They often come with strings attached. In some cases, you have to give up your legal rights to sue the other party or insurance company. Furthermore, once you agree to a settlement, you may never be able to reverse it. That’s why you should always consult a lawyer before accepting any settlement offer.
